Andy Roddick falls  View/Post Comments (2)

Posted on January 27th, 2004. About Tennis.

Andy Roddick loses in th Australian open in the quarter finals against the Russian Safin 2-6, 6-3, 7-5 6-7(0), 6-4.
Safin meets Andre Agassi in the Semi-Finals.
Roddick is goin to lose his number one ranking beginning next week when the ATP releases the new rankings.

Riddles  View/Post Comments (2)

Posted on January 25th, 2004. About Jokes/Riddles.

I’ll be posting some riddles from time to time. I’ll post the answers in the comments later on. PS: These riddles are taken from Riddlenut

A boy was at a carnival and went to a booth where a man said to the boy, “If I write your exact weight on this piece of paper then you have to give me $50, but if I cannot, I will pay you $50.”

The boy looked around and saw no scale so he agrees, thinking no matter what the carny writes he’ll just say he weighs more or less.

In the end the boy ended up paying the man $50. How did the man win the bet?
